In 2025, AI did not revolutionize cyber attacks as predicted. Instead, adversaries used AI to accelerate traditional tradecraft, focusing on speed and accessibility rather than new offensive capabilities. The article examines several case studies showcasing AI-generated scripts for credential theft and browser exploitation. These attacks, while faster and more accessible to less-skilled operators, still rely on familiar techniques detectable by basic security measures. The outlook for 2026 suggests continued AI-driven commoditization of tradecraft, with more templated attacks and improved phishing attempts. However, fundamental security practices remain effective against these evolving threats.
